Service outcomes in physical and sexual abuse cases: a comparison of child advocacy center-based and standard services.

Smith DW, Witte TH, Fricker-Elhai AE

National Crime Victims Research and Treatment Center, Medical University of South Carolina, 165 Cannon Street, Charleston, SC 29425, USA. smithdw@musc.edu

Child Advocacy Centers (CACs) were developed to improve on child abuse investigative services provided by child protective service (CPS) agencies. However, until very recently, there has been little research comparing CAC-based procedures and outcomes to those in CPS investigations not based in CACs. The current study tracked 76 child abuse cases that were reported to authorities and investigated through either a private, not-for-profit CAC or typical CPS services in a mid-south rural county. Comparisons between CAC and CPS cases were made in terms of involvement of local law enforcement in the investigation, provision of medical exams, abuse substantiation rates, mental health referrals, prosecution referrals, and conviction rates. Analyses revealed higher rates of law enforcement involvement, medical examinations, and case substantiation in the CAC-based cases compared to the CPS cases. Despite limitations due to sample size and non-randomization, this study found preliminary support for the assumptions underlying the establishment of CACs.

Published 17 October 2006 in Child Maltreat, 11(4): 354-60.
